8-3-2. Contents of the remote output RY (M → R)
Name
Command processing
request 1
Command processing
request 2
WRITE_READ
Operation pattern 0 to 3
ZERO command
RESET command
HOLD command
Value selection 1
Error reset request flag
Turn ON when writing the pre-set values of the operation pattern limited data.
Before turning OFF, make sure the [Command processing response 1] is ON.
The [Command processing request 1] saves the per-set values.
Turn ON when writing the commands.
Before turning OFF, make sure the [Command processing response 2] is ON.
Although the [Command processing request 2] saves the pre-set values, the
[Command processing request 2] clears the obtained values of the "command for the
control input signals."
Select the WRITE/READ of the commands.
OFF: WRITE, ON: READ
Change the operation pattern by turning ON one of the operation pattern 0 to 3.
Execute the DIGITAL ZERO function at the rising edge.
During ON, keep executing the DIGITAL ZERO function.
Cancel the DIGITAL ZERO function at the falling edge.
Reset the Hold mode at the rising edge.
During ON, Keep executing the DIGITAL ZERO function.
Cancel the Hold mode reset at the falling edge.
Control the Hold mode at the rising edge and falling edge.
When the Hold mode is "Interval-specified peak hold", in the same manner as the
control input signals, the product operates as follows.
Rising edge: Starts detecting data.
During ON: Detecting interval
Falling edge: Starts Holding interval
Change the value to be output, into the [Indicated value_Selection] data area of the
Remote register: R → M.
(Valid when the No. of occupied stations is 1 or 2.)
OFF: Measured value (tracking value)
ON: Holding value (indicated value)
Error state flag was turned ON by any error occurred.
Turn ON the error reset request flag when the error state flag is turned OFF.
